  • May 1, 2024 | forrester.com | Michael O'Grady |Christopher Gilchrist |Charles Betz

    The IT services industry is often overlooked, even though it captures more than a third of annual global tech spend — some four times the annual spend on computer equipment. Forrester forecasts that by 2028, annual spend on IT services will reach $2 trillion. Despite this forecasted growth, IT service firms face challenges in the next few years, including retaining talent and balancing headcount with increased competition from software and engineering firms, and the effects of generative AI.
